Taxonomic Classification

Rank Brown-barred Dwarf Dryad Monkey
Kingdom same Animalia (Animals)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um Arthropoda (Arthropods) Chordata (Chordates)
Class Insecta (Insects) Mammalia (Mammals)
Order Lepidoptera (Butterflies & Moths) Primates (Primates)
Family Elachistidae Cercopithecidae (Old World Monkeys)
Genus Elachista Chlorocebus
Species Elachista subocellea Chlorocebus dryas

Evolutionary Relationship

Brown-barred Dwarf and Dryad Monkey share a common ancestor at the Kingdom level: Animalia. (Animals)
